Palm and IBM Enter Reseller Agreement

Alliance Provides Customers With Upgrade Path, Expands Market

SANTA CLARA, Calif., July 23 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Palm, Inc. (Nasdaq: PALM) today announced an agreement through which IBM becomes a U.S. reseller of Palm(TM) handheld computers. The agreement not only broadens the handheld product choices for IBM's large customers, but also brings Palm handhelds to the attention of small- and medium-size businesses that purchase from IBM. Customers can now purchase any Palm handheld -- from the entry-level Palm m100 series to the higher-end Palm m500 series, or the Palm i705 handheld with integrated wireless(1) -- from IBM.

"Palm understands the intense demands of a company's mobile fleet and makes products that meet their needs, whether in a business group, across a corporation through the IT department, or for a small business," said Glenn Cross, senior vice president, Americas Sales, Services, and Enterprise Business Development, Solutions Group, Palm, Inc. "As we continue to make strides into the enterprise, relationships with business leaders like IBM strengthen our position and help us to better serve all our enterprise customers. Being chosen as an IBM supplier of handhelds is clearly a compliment to our technology and reaffirms our role as a champion for the mobile enterprise."
